5KP6.5C-B Product Overview

Introduction

The 5KP6.5C-B belongs to the category of transient voltage suppressor diodes and is widely used for surge protection in various electronic circuits. This entry provides a comprehensive overview of the 5KP6.5C-B, including its basic information, specifications, pin configuration, functional features, advantages and disadvantages, working principles, application field plans, and alternative models.

Basic Information Overview

  • Category: Transient Voltage Suppressor Diode
  • Use: Surge protection in electronic circuits
  • Characteristics: High power capability, fast response time, low clamping voltage
  • Package: Axial leaded, DO-201 package
  • Essence: Protects electronic devices from voltage surges
  • Packaging/Quantity: Available in reels or bulk packaging, quantity varies based on supplier

Specifications

  • Peak Power Dissipation: 5000W
  • Breakdown Voltage: 6.5V
  • Maximum Clamping Voltage: 10.5V
  • Operating Temperature Range: -55°C to +175°C
  • Storage Temperature Range: -55°C to +175°C

Detailed Pin Configuration

The 5KP6.5C-B has an axial leaded package with two leads. The anode is connected to one lead, and the cathode is connected to the other lead.

Working Principles

The 5KP6.5C-B operates by diverting excess voltage away from sensitive components when a surge occurs. When the voltage exceeds the breakdown voltage, the diode conducts, shunting the excess current to protect the connected circuitry.

Detailed Application Field Plans

The 5KP6.5C-B is commonly used in various applications, including: - Power supplies - Telecommunication equipment - Automotive electronics - Industrial control systems - Consumer electronics

Detailed and Complete Alternative Models

Some alternative models to the 5KP6.5C-B include: - 1.5KE6.5A - P6SMB6.5A - SMAJ6.5A - SA6.5CA

These alternative models offer similar surge protection capabilities and can be considered based on specific application requirements.
